The project involves the restyling of a large apartment in the Milan 2 area. Here the real challenge was to intervene in an already designed and defined environment that, however, did not reflect the clients “character. In fact, we started from an existing floor plan of which we kept only the parquet floor and the wall elements of the kitchen, intervening in the choice of furniture and finishes. The clients” classic and elegant taste was the starting point and strength of our intervention.
The client, Marcella Galantino, a 38-year-old manager in Coca-cola of Valtellina origin who over the years has lived in several foreign countries first for study and then for work, recounts her experience, “I love customization and attention to detail, I like to have a style that reflects me, and I love to do the same in the home because I believe that the place where we live should, not only be a pleasant place to come back to at the end of the day, but should be able to tell about us.”

Project Details.

The main space is the living room, which was designed to accommodate a large dining area enhanced by a table with armchairs at which a striking hanging lamp was placed, composed of multiple circular elements in mother-of-pearl by Verpan. The other part of the room, however, was designed as a relaxation area with contemporary-style furniture such as the sofa and armchair upholstered in a pumpkin-colored fabric that contrasts with the neutral tones used for the rest of the room. A custom wall was also designed that includes the bookcase and a bio-fireplace fully recessed and flush with the structure covered with a marble effect. Detail accentuating the clients’ classic style was the wood paneling applied as decoration to embellish the walls.
When we saw the large opening to the terrace then, it was impossible not to propose to the clients a large slim frame window that we, and they, immediately fell in love with. This allowed us to get a very bright environment and to have more continuity between inside and outside. As for the kitchen environment, on the other hand, the wallpaper on the front wall of the island, equipped with stools, which recalls the theme of nature, is of strong impact.
This theme served as a common thread among the different spaces recalling “The Secret Keys” repurposed in the hallway and the headboard wall of the master bedroom. What inspired us is the rich vegetation that can be glimpsed from the windows of the apartment that enraptured us from the first meeting with the clients in their home.
